7+ Waterfall Pump Size Calculators & Tools

A tool designed to determine the appropriate pump specifications for a given waterfall feature considers factors such as flow rate, head height, and pipe diameter. For example, a landscaper planning a backyard waterfall might use such a tool to ensure the pump delivers enough water to achieve the desired visual effect.

Correctly sizing a pump is essential for optimal waterfall performance and energy efficiency. An undersized pump will struggle to lift water to the desired height, resulting in a weak or nonexistent waterfall. Conversely, an oversized pump wastes energy and can create excessive splashing or erosion. Historically, determining pump size involved complex calculations and often relied on trial and error. These digital tools streamline the process, making accurate sizing accessible to professionals and DIY enthusiasts alike.

Brinell to HRC Hardness Converter | Calculator

Converting Brinell hardness measurements to Rockwell C scale values is a common practice in materials science and engineering. This conversion facilitates comparisons between different hardness testing methods and allows engineers to utilize data from various sources. For example, legacy data might be available in Brinell values, while newer specifications require Rockwell C. A tool facilitating this conversion simplifies data analysis and ensures compatibility.

This conversion process simplifies materials selection and quality control by providing a unified hardness scale for assessment. Historically, different hardness tests arose due to variations in material properties and testing capabilities. Bridging these scales streamlines communication and avoids potential misunderstandings. Access to reliable conversion tools ensures data accuracy and consistency, which is crucial for informed decision-making in engineering applications.

Best Plumbing Drain Slope Calculator & Chart

A tool designed to determine the proper incline for drainage pipes ensures efficient wastewater removal. For instance, it helps determine the vertical drop a pipe needs over a specific horizontal distance, commonly expressed as a fraction or percentage. This ensures optimal flow velocity, preventing clogs and backups.

Correct pipe inclination is crucial for proper sanitation and building integrity. Insufficient slope can lead to standing water, promoting bacterial growth and foul odors. Conversely, excessive slope can cause water to drain too quickly, leaving solids behind and leading to blockages. Historically, plumbers relied on experience and simple rules of thumb. Modern tools provide more precise calculations, accommodating various pipe sizes and materials for optimal performance and adherence to building codes.

Best Carbon Equivalent Calculator | Free Tool

A tool used to convert the impact of various greenhouse gases into a unified metric, typically expressed as carbon dioxide equivalents (CO2e), allows for simplified comparisons and aggregated reporting of emissions from diverse sources. For instance, the warming effect of methane over a given period can be expressed as an amount of CO2 producing the same warming effect.

This standardized approach facilitates comprehensive environmental impact assessments and supports more effective climate change mitigation strategies. By providing a common unit of measurement, it empowers organizations to track their overall environmental footprint, identify areas for improvement, and comply with regulatory requirements concerning greenhouse gas emissions. Historically, the increasing awareness of the diverse range of greenhouse gases and their varied global warming potentials necessitated a method for simplified accounting and comparison, leading to the development of such tools.

Best IPPT Calculator & Score Estimator

A tool designed to estimate scores for the Individual Physical Proficiency Test (IPPT), this resource typically takes inputs such as age, gender, and performance times or repetitions for each station (push-ups, sit-ups, and 2.4km run). It then processes these inputs based on the official IPPT scoring system to provide an estimated overall score and award. For example, inputting a time of 11 minutes for the 2.4km run, along with specific numbers of push-ups and sit-ups, will generate a projected score and associated award (e.g., Gold, Silver, Pass).

Such tools offer several advantages, including pre-test performance prediction, personalized training goal setting, and motivation for improvement. Historically, manual calculation or reliance on published tables was necessary. Digital tools offer convenience, speed, and accuracy. These advancements are important considering the significance of the IPPT within specific organizations and the personal fitness goals of individuals.

Linux File Permission Calculator & Converter

A common task for Linux system administrators involves calculating and setting file system permissions. These permissions, represented numerically (octal) or symbolically (rwx), control access for the owner, group, and others. Tools and online resources exist to simplify this process by converting between numeric and symbolic representations, visually demonstrating the effects of different permission settings, and even generating command-line instructions for applying them. For example, a user may wish to grant read and execute access to a group while denying all access to others. A utility designed for this purpose could translate the symbolic representation “rw-r—–” into its octal equivalent “750” and further produce the command `chmod 750 filename`.

Accurate permission management is crucial for system security and stability. Incorrect settings can lead to vulnerabilities, data breaches, or system instability. Historically, understanding and applying permissions correctly required manual calculations and a thorough understanding of the underlying octal system. Modern tools streamline this process, reducing the risk of human error and improving efficiency. Best Sun Tan Calculator & UV Index

A tool designed to estimate safe sun exposure times helps individuals personalize their sunbathing experience based on factors like skin type, location, and time of day. This typically involves inputting information like skin tone (ranging from very fair to very dark), the Sun Protection Factor (SPF) of any sunscreen used, and the current UV index. The output often provides a recommended time limit for sun exposure before the risk of sunburn becomes significant. For example, someone with fair skin using SPF 30 on a high UV index day might receive a recommended exposure time of 20 minutes.

Estimating safe sun exposure durations is crucial for skin health. Overexposure to ultraviolet (UV) radiation contributes significantly to sunburn, premature aging, and increases the risk of skin cancer. Such a tool empowers individuals to make informed decisions about their time in the sun, minimizing potential harm while still enjoying its benefits. While traditional sun safety advice often provides general guidelines, a personalized approach based on individual factors and real-time data offers a more precise and effective way to manage sun exposure. This represents a significant advancement from generic advice and aligns with increasing public awareness of sun safety.
